WebAug 7, 2012 · 2) Reboot you device into fastboot mode and connect to your computer; 3) Make sure your computer sees your device by typing: fastboot devices 4) Boot CWM by typing: fastboot boot cwm.img 5) Pull all the files from /sdcard by typing: adb pull …

Next, select "Computer name, domain, and workgroup settings" and click on the "Change settings" link located on the ... hirst lane shipleyWebOct 11, 2024 · Because userspace fastboot and recovery are similar, you can merge them into one partition or binary. This provides advantages such as using less space, having fewer partitions overall, and having fastboot and recovery share their kernel and libraries. hirst lane signal box
